    What Makes a Mattress Firm?

    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ty. What exactly makes a mattress firm? It's not just about feeling hard when you press on it. A truly firm mattress is designed with specific materials and construction techniques that provide optimal support and minimize sinkage. The core of a firm mattress usually consists of high-density foam or a robust innerspring system. High-density foam means the foam is packed tightly, offering less give and more resistance. This type of foam is excellent for maintaining its shape and providing consistent support over time. Innerspring systems in firm mattresses often feature a higher coil count and thicker gauge coils. This combination creates a sturdier and more supportive sleep surface. The coil count refers to the number of individual coils within the mattress; more coils generally mean better support and durability. The gauge of the coils refers to their thickness; thicker coils provide a firmer feel. Another factor contributing to firmness is the layering of materials. Firm mattresses typically have fewer comfort layers (the soft layers on top) compared to plush or medium mattresses. This lack of thick, cushioning layers ensures that you feel the supportive core of the mattress more directly. The overall design focuses on preventing excessive contouring, which can lead to spinal misalignment. In essence, a firm mattress is all about providing a stable and even surface that keeps your body properly aligned throughout the night. This type of mattress is particularly beneficial for those who need extra support, such as back and stomach sleepers, as it helps prevent the hips from sinking too far into the mattress, which can cause lower back pain. Understanding these components will help you better evaluate different mattresses and choose one that meets your specific needs and preferences. So, when you're shopping around, pay attention to the materials used, the coil count and gauge (if it's an innerspring), and the thickness of the comfort layers. This will give you a clearer picture of how firm the mattress truly is.

    Benefits of Sleeping on a Firm Mattress

    So, why should you even consider a firm mattress in the first place? Well, there are tons of benefits, especially if you're the type of person who needs extra support while you sleep. A major advantage of a firm mattress is its ability to promote proper spinal alignment. When you sleep on a too-soft mattress, your hips and shoulders can sink in too deeply, causing your spine to curve out of its natural position. Over time, this can lead to back pain, stiffness, and other discomforts. A firm mattress, on the other hand, provides a stable and even surface that keeps your spine aligned, reducing the risk of these issues. Another key benefit is improved support for back and stomach sleepers. Back sleepers need a mattress that supports the natural curvature of their spine, while stomach sleepers need a mattress that prevents their hips from sinking too far into the mattress. A firm mattress provides the necessary support for both of these sleep positions, ensuring a comfortable and restful night's sleep. In addition to spinal alignment and support, a firm mattress can also help reduce motion transfer. This is particularly important for couples who share a bed, as it means you're less likely to be disturbed by your partner's movements during the night. Mattresses with good motion isolation can significantly improve the quality of your sleep, especially if you're a light sleeper. Furthermore, firm mattresses tend to be more durable than softer mattresses. The high-density materials used in their construction make them more resistant to sagging and wear over time. This means you can expect your firm mattress to last longer and maintain its support for years to come. Lastly, many people find that a firm mattress helps them maintain a better posture throughout the day. By providing proper support during sleep, a firm mattress can help train your body to maintain a more upright and aligned posture, which can have numerous benefits for your overall health and well-being. In conclusion, sleeping on a firm mattress offers a wide range of benefits, from improved spinal alignment and support to reduced motion transfer and increased durability. If you're looking for a mattress that will help you sleep better and feel better, a firm mattress is definitely worth considering.

    Maintaining Your iBest Firm Mattress

    So, you've got your iBest firm mattress – congrats! Now, how do you keep it in tip-top shape so it lasts for years to come? Proper maintenance is key to ensuring that your mattress remains comfortable and supportive. First off, protect your investment with a mattress protector. A good mattress protector will shield your mattress from spills, stains, and allergens, helping to prolong its lifespan. Look for a waterproof and breathable protector that fits snugly over your mattress. Vacuum your mattress regularly to remove dust, dirt, and debris. Use the upholstery attachment on your vacuum cleaner to gently clean the surface of the mattress. Pay extra attention to seams and crevices where dust can accumulate. Rotate your mattress every few months to prevent uneven wear. This will help distribute the weight more evenly and prevent sagging in certain areas. If your mattress is two-sided, flip it over as well. Avoid jumping or standing on your mattress, as this can damage the internal components and cause premature wear. While it might be tempting to use your bed as a trampoline, it's not worth the risk of damaging your mattress. Clean spills immediately to prevent stains and odors. Use a mild detergent and a damp cloth to gently blot the affected area. Avoid using harsh chemicals or excessive water, as this can damage the mattress. Air out your mattress regularly to keep it fresh and prevent the buildup of moisture. Open the windows and let the mattress air out for a few hours, especially after cleaning it. Consider using a mattress encasement if you have allergies or asthma. A mattress encasement completely surrounds the mattress, creating a barrier against dust mites, allergens, and bed bugs. By following these simple tips, you can keep your iBest firm mattress in excellent condition and enjoy a comfortable and supportive night's sleep for years to come. Remember, a well-maintained mattress is an investment in your health and well-being.
